The text explores the dual nature of humanity as both earthly and divine, drawing parallels from various cultural and religious narratives, including the Book of Genesis and Gnostic texts like Pistis Sophia. It emphasizes that creation involves a movement from unity to fragmentation and back toward relational restoration, highlighting the importance of connection with the divine.
